ME1 2QY is a residential postcode in Rochester, Medway. It was first introduced in September 2002.
The most common council tax band is G.
Residential buildings are primarily detached. Domestic properties are primarily houses.
Estimated residential property values, based on historical transactions and adjusted for inflation, range from £110,000 to £764,484 with an average of £627,444.
Residential buildings were typically constructed between 1996 and 2002 and between 2003 and 2006.
64% of residential property sales since 1995 have been new builds or newly converted.
Domestic properties are mostly owner occupied, with some privately rented
The most common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) ratings are D and C.
Rochester is a town, which had a population of 62,982 in the 2011 census.
In the 2011 census, there were 74 people resident in ME1 2QY, of which 37 were male and 37 were female. This includes overnight visitors as well as permanent residents.
ME1 2QY is in the Medway travel to work area. NHS services are provided by the Medway Primary Care Trust.
ME1 2QY is approximately 85m (279ft) above sea level.
